well, i have had a small miss under heavy throttle for a while now. it has always been only when the truck had sat for a while (atleast a day or 2) and its always went away after just a few minutes. i figured that since its burning oil (im not sure why yet) the plugs were getting damp, and the miss went away after the oil burnt off. well a few days ago, the miss started to go away, then it came back worse than ever. i thought maybe i had a spark plug that wasnt sparking, so i took them off one at a time and ran the engine, but it seems like they are all doing something. i havent pulled any yet though. i have checked for codes, and heres what i came up with
31 - EVP circuit below min voltage
-
63 - TP circuit below min voltage
32 - EVP voltage below closed limit
29 - insufficient input from VSS
-
31 - EVP circuit below min voltage
77 - operator error - dynamic response/cylinder balance
now i have always had one code or another that was telling me my egr wasnt working right. im assuming that TP is throttle position. ive replaced the tps with a known good used part. i dont understand why i would have a vss code, i dont even have a vss. and as for the 'goose test' i gave it full throttle when i was prompted, im not sure why it would say theres an error. anybody have any input?
